The KOSPI index was higher in early trading on the 23rd. The move is seen as reflecting gains in the three major U.S. indexes overnight on a Santa rally. The KOSPI started by breaking above the 4,120 level.

As of 9:05 a.m., the KOSPI index was up 0.21% (8.62 points) from the previous session at 4,114.55. The KOSPI opened at 4,127.40, up 21.47 points (0.52%) from the previous day.

Individuals are leading the main board. Individuals were net buyers of 14 billion won, while foreigners and institutions were net sellers of 8.5 billion won and 700 million won, respectively.

Large-cap stocks on the main board are mixed. Samsung Electronics, SK hynix, Samsung Biologics, HD Hyundai Heavy Industries, and Doosan Enerbility are rising, while LG Energy Solution, KB Financial Group, and Kia are falling.

At the same time, the KOSDAQ index was up 0.39 point (0.04%) from the previous day at 929.53. The KOSDAQ opened at 932.48, up 3.34 points (0.36%) from the previous day.

Individuals are also leading the KOSDAQ market. Individuals were net buyers of 78.4 billion won, while foreigners and institutions were dumping 43.8 billion won and 6.5 billion won, respectively.

Top KOSDAQ market-cap stocks are also mixed. Alteogen, ABL Bio, Rainbow Robotics, and HLB are rising, but EcoPro, LigaChem Biosciences, Kolon TissueGene, Peptron, and Sam Chun Dang Pharm are falling.

The three major U.S. indexes closed higher overnight. With year-end holidays approaching, buying focused on tech stocks flowed in, which is analyzed as a Santa rally effect.

The Dow Jones Industrial Average finished 227.79 points (0.47%) higher at 48,362.68. The Standard & Poor's (S&P) 500 rose 43.99 points (0.64%) to 6,878.49, and the Nasdaq composite added 121.21 points (0.52%) to end at 23,428.83.

As the year-end holiday period began, trading was relatively light. For the S&P 500, trading volume was about half of that on the 19th. In this environment, bargain hunting continued on expectations for a Santa rally.
